Ramesh Chander is a seasoned storage and systems software engineer with 13 years designing high-performance, scalable storage platforms for enterprise and cloud environments. Currently an SDE on Amazon Aurora, he previously led storage platform work at Agylstor and built flash-based enterprise storage and backup scalability features at SanDisk and NetApp. His background spans low-level embedded and Linux kernel work to cloud-native storage services, giving him a rare full-stack perspective on storage performance, reliability, and operational concerns. Based in San Jose, he blends hands-on engineering with production-focused architecture, routinely delivering solutions that bridge hardware-aware optimization and distributed systems design. Notably, his career includes early work on parallel file systems and grid storage at C-DAC, reflecting long-standing expertise in scalable storage infrastructures.
